- We are seeking a Business Analyst with hands\-on experience in business process mapping, analyzing and documenting business requirements, data mapping, and planning test activities. The ideal candidate will have a solid understanding of both business operations and technical workflows, with a proven ability to translate complex processes into clear documentation. Familiarity with ITIL (IT Infrastructure Library) frameworks, including its policies, procedures, and best practices, is important for aligning with IT service management standards.
The role requires strong experience with collaboration tools such as SharePoint , and the ability to work both independently and as part of a team. Managing multiple initiatives simultaneously while maintaining accuracy and meeting deadlines is a key expectation. Strong communication skills are essentialβyou must be able to explain technical concepts in a way that non\-technical stakeholders can easily understand, both in written documentation and during discussions or presentations. Additionally, this role may require you to act as an Agile Product Owner when needed, supporting the business teams by prioritizing requirements, managing backlogs, and working closely with development teams throughout the Agile lifecycle.
